Isolated histiocytosis X of the pituitary gland: case report

Neurosurgery. 1987 Nov;21(5):718-21. doi: 10.1227/00006123-198711000-00020.

Abstract

The authors describe a case of a granuloma of histiocytosis X localized in the pituitary gland. The patient presented with diabetes insipidus and hyperprolactinemia. The diagnosis was established by surgical removal of the pituitary lesion through a transsphenoidal approach. The clinical and pathological aspects of the case are discussed.
